How much does a Cashier earn in Sheboygan, WI?

The average cashier in Sheboygan, WI earns between $21,000 and $35,000 annually. This compares to the national average cashier range of $21,000 to $36,000.

Average Cashier Salary In Sheboygan, WI

$27,000
